Output 0537448d3581790e84f29a54653976dac987cb704cc588dbbe77f6cb65f74e3d:0

value
344391
script pubkey
OP_0 OP_PUSHBYTES_20 31de903887897b25eaae599b062c0329da70ac63
address
bc1qx80fqwy839ajt64wtxdsvtqr98d8ptrre2w0x0
transaction
0537448d3581790e84f29a54653976dac987cb704cc588dbbe77f6cb65f74e3d
spent
true